  2. AIP SUP - Valid AIP SUP and AIP AIRAC SUP

    AIP SUP is normally used to publish temporary changes to the AIP for conditions exceeding three months or changes that contain a lot of text/graphics. Data and information to be announced as AIP AIRAC SUP are specified in Annex 15, Chapter 6.

  4. AIC - Valid AIC Documents

    AIC should contain information about aviation conditions that do not qualify for publication in the AIP or NOTAM in accordance with the provisions in ICAO Annex 15 ch. 7.

  8. M517-AIR

    M517-AIR is an electronic version of the military VFR chart M517-AIR 1:250,000 for Norway. The chart is regularly updated in accordance with the AIRAC cycle. Changes to the chart within the AIRAC cycle are published on NOTAM for Norway.

Declaration of Conformity

For specific aerodromes in Norway there are special requirements for aircraft operators performing commercial transportation.

The aircraft operator shall document fulfilment of the requirements above to CAA Norway at least 14 days prior to commencing operations. CAA Norway will, after evaluating the documentation and finding it adequate, issue a letter of compliance

Additional information for operators

Some general considerations addressing challenges one might meet during operations in Norway, and the most relevant factors resulting in an AD’s categorization, are described in the document Additional information for operators.

This information is not required by ICAO Annex 15, and updates do not follow the AIRAC-cycle. The information should be considered advisory.
